JOHN "JACK" MURDOCH John "Jack" Murdoch, age 60, of Raleigh, NC, formerly of Duluth, GA passed away January 12, 2006. He was born in Calgary, Alberta, Canada on December 7, 1945. Jack grew up working in his father's farm equipment business and after completing his education, joined Massey-Ferguson, Inc. He spent the next 36 years with the company and its successor company AGCO Corp. Starting as a clerk in the Calgary, Alberta regional office, he rose quickly over the years with increased sales and marketing responsibilities throughout North America, residing in Racine, WI, Des Moines, IA, Dallas, TX, Raleigh, NC, Duluth, GA. and Leamington Spa, England. From 1994 -1997, Jack served as Vice President Sales & Marketing of the International Division based in Coventry, England, with responsibilities for Europe, Africa and the Middle East. He returned to Duluth, GA and remained there holding senior management sales & marketing positions until his retirement in 2001. Jack was well-known and greatly respected throughout the worldwide farm machinery industry. After retiring, he thoroughly enjoyed a weekly round of golf and spending time with friends and extended family. Jack was also active in Kiwanis Club and church activities.
